AGARTALA, July 23 (TIWN): Wrong display of roman digit in a clock placed in the Ashtami Market at Old Agartala a source for humours for locals. The clock which shows time, a wrong display of roman digit has become a laughing stock.
It is worthy to mention that the state government which has been so much concern about the betterment of the state public fails to witness the wrongly displayed clock at the Ashtami Market.
In the clock where the digit 4 would be curved as IV in roman, it is placed as IIII.
People moving across the market have been making fun of the clock. Most of the passerby depends over the timing of clock. Even the students and kids learn measurement of the time from the clock.
However, the clock which has been the identity of the market and the area has become a laughing stock.
The market has been running well but the wrong display of the clock has created humour in the market.
“We mostly look at the clock for the time as it is easy for us to look at. Therefore, despite of wrong roman digit also we manage”, said a shopkeeper. But it is shameful that spending lakhs over the construction of the building a major mistake in the identity of the area left a deep scar on the beautiful construction.
